We are seeking a Project Coordinator to support project operations toward execution of Infleqtion’s quantum computing roadmap. The ideal candidate brings strong operations discipline, desire to learn and create new processes, and help teammates by offloading operations tasks. With you around, nothing falls through the cracks! 

Job Responsibilities 

The duties and responsibilities outlined below include essential functions of the role. Depending on business needs, this role may perform a combination of some or all of the following duties. Duties, responsibilities, and activities may change, or new ones may be assigned at any time. 

  • Operational & Facilities Support: Coordinate and execute day-to-day operational tasks including light equipment maintenance (e.g., UPS batteries, monitors), follow materials inventory procedures, pickup and distribution of orders, and acting as a go-between for shipping & receiving, IT, vendors, and engineering/R&D teams. 
  • Project & Proposal Support: Coordinate and support proposal development, including support for statement of work development and budget scoping. Upon project award, support technical leads in project execution, including deliverable and schedule tracking, budget tracking, inventory management, purchasing, subcontract communications, and progress reporting. Engage with technical leaders to ensure alignment of resources with technical objectives. Support execution management practices: tracking risks, tasks, dependencies, deliverables. 
  • Operational Communications: Serve as a primary internal point of contact between Quantum Computing R&D/Engineering/Program Management and company stakeholders in finance, facilities, marketing, and legal. 
  • Process, Compliance & Controls: Support and enforce internal processes such as export control (internally and with vendors), IT security procedures (e.g. secure storage), legal handling of sensitive information, reliability tracking, and periodic follow-ups on open IT and compliance tickets. 
  • Scheduling, Coordination & Follow-ups: Assist with complex scheduling, scrum rituals, and ad-hoc meetings; track action items; assist with trainings, timesheets, communications, and other required responses. 
  • Tools, Tracking & Reporting: Maintain and monitor Jira boards (scrum boards and Gantt charts, purchase requests), track reliability and process adherence, ensure seeding meeting notes in Confluence, answer charge code questions, and assist with timesheets completion based on calendar data.

Infleqtion, Inc. (NYSE: INFQ) is a global leader in quantum technology, delivering neutral atom solutions for quantum computing, networking, sensing, and security. With a product portfolio spanning quantum computers, quantum optical clocks, RF receivers, and inertial sensors, Infleqtion’s full-stack approach combines high-performance hardware with the company’s proprietary Superstaq quantum computing software platform. Infleqtion’s systems are already in use by the U.S. Department of War, NASA, the U.K. government, and in multiple collaborations with NVIDIA. Infleqtion, in collaboration with NVIDIA, published the world’s first demonstration of a materials science application using logical qubits. With operations in the U.S., Europe, and Asia, Infleqtion meets the demands of government and commercial customers across the space, defense, energy, finance and telecommunications sectors.
